Stefanutti Stocks Holdings Limited (JSE:SSK)
South Africa flag South Africa · Delayed Price · Currency is ZAR · Price in ZAc
429.00
-1.00 (-0.23%)
At close: Feb 13, 2026

JSE:SSK Ratios and Metrics

Millions ZAR. Fiscal year is Mar - Feb.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Feb '25 Feb '24 Feb '23 Feb '22 Feb '21
7176251872448042
Market Cap Growth
9.16%233.93%-23.29%204.17%92.00%13.64%
Enterprise Value
1,6531,1247931,1741,0532,054
Last Close Price
4.293.741.121.460.480.25
PE Ratio
3.214.7611.7916.74--
Forward PE
-4.324.324.324.324.32
PS Ratio
0.090.080.030.040.010.01
PB Ratio
10.3438.35-3.62-3.68-0.890.12
P/TBV Ratio
-----6.06
P/FCF Ratio
-176.990.611.50--
P/OCF Ratio
-4.090.541.22--
PEG Ratio
-0.290.290.290.290.29
EV/Sales Ratio
0.210.150.110.190.180.44
EV/EBITDA Ratio
3.783.154.149.9112.2555.04
EV/EBIT Ratio
5.333.975.3814.0933.23-
EV/FCF Ratio
-5.56318.092.577.21--
Debt / Equity Ratio
19.0377.32-23.19-20.12-15.814.41
Debt / EBITDA Ratio
3.013.375.8410.6916.5641.65
Debt / FCF Ratio
-356.853.888.20--
Net Debt / Equity Ratio
13.4747.06-8.59-11.41-11.062.21
Net Debt / EBITDA Ratio
2.212.152.326.3911.5820.91
Net Debt / FCF Ratio
-3.14217.181.444.65-2.80-1.63
Asset Turnover
1.441.511.381.241.190.78
Inventory Turnover
138.51155.66141.83116.90108.6637.18
Quick Ratio
0.660.610.680.630.610.63
Current Ratio
0.790.780.830.830.790.88
Return on Equity (ROE)
-----206.77%-44.43%
Return on Assets (ROA)
3.66%3.47%1.80%1.07%0.40%-0.96%
Return on Invested Capital (ROIC)
27.18%39.70%7.09%10.45%3.11%-7.14%
Return on Capital Employed (ROCE)
85.50%112.00%107.80%42.60%72.60%-14.90%
Earnings Yield
24.67%21.02%8.48%5.97%-517.22%-694.03%
FCF Yield
-41.45%0.56%164.94%66.69%-441.95%-1143.19%
Buyback Yield / Dilution
-3.48%-4.44%----
Updated Aug 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.